1. How many grams of Mg(OH)2 are there in 4.5 moles?
2. 275g of Al(NO3)3 is equal to how many moles?

Respuesta :

nancyvo68 nancyvo68
  • 04-02-2021

Answer:

1) 262 grams

Explanation:

Mg = 24.305g

O = 16g

H = 1

24.305 +2(16)+2(1) = 58.305 g

×[tex]\frac{58.305g}{1} = \frac{x }{4.5 } =262.37 g[/tex]
